The cheapest way to get from Oxford to Andoversford is to bus which costs £2 - £4 and takes 1h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Oxford to Andoversford is to drive which takes 47 min and costs £8 - £13.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Magdalen Street and arriving at Cattle Market. Services depart every three h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 25m.
The distance between Oxford and Andoversford is 37 miles. The road distance is 35.8 miles.
The best way to get from Oxford to Andoversford without a car is to bus which takes 1h 25m and costs £2 - £4.
The bus from Magdalen Street to Cattle Market takes 1h 25m including transfers and departs every three hours.
Oxford to Andoversford bus services, operated by Pulhams Coaches, depart from Magdalen Street station.
Oxford to Andoversford bus services, operated by Pulhams Coaches, arrive at Cattle Market station.
Yes, the driving distance between Oxford to Andoversford is 36 miles. It takes approximately 47 min to drive from Oxford to Andoversford.
